27Power to decline certain participation requestsS

This section has no associated Explanatory Notes

(1)Subsection (2) applies where—

(a)a participation request (a “new request”) is made to a public service authority,

(b)the new request relates to matters that are the same, or substantially the same, as matters contained in a previous participation request (a “previous request”), and

(c)the previous request was made in the period of two years ending with the date on which the new request is made.

(2)The public service authority may decline to consider the new request.

(3)For the purposes of subsection (1)(b), a new request relates to matters that are the same, or substantially the same, as matters contained in a previous request only if both requests relate to—

(a)the same public service, and

(b)the same, or substantially the same, outcome that results from, or is contributed to by virtue of, the provision of the public service.

(4)For the purposes of this section, it is irrelevant whether the body making a new request is the same body as, or a different body from, that which made the previous request.
